The purpose of this program is to observe the laws of Nature at work throughout the body.
Phase I will cover:
Dr Sutherland's approach to Osteopathy in the Cranial Field in the later years of his life, when he was working with Balanced Fluid Tension (BFT).
This course will also review
- Biomechanical and Functional methodology of Balanced Membranous Tension (B.M.T.)
- Explore Motion present.
- Biodynamic methodology of Patient's Neutral, natural boundaries,
- Synchronization with Primary Respiration,
- Sutherland perceptual odyssey,
- C.N.S embryological development and function,
- Natural Disengagement with B.M.T and B.F.T.,
- Fluid fulcrums, Intraosseous patterns of motion.
Phase II will cover:
-
The concept of the 'fluid body' through an in-depth perception of fluid dynamics and its clinical significance.
-
Appreciation of the therapeutic and diagnostic use of Balanced Fluid Tension (BFT) around the fulcrum incited by the tidal forces.
-
Observation of the Longitudinal Fluctuation will be used as a diagnostic tool. CV4-EV4 treatment and its clinical relevance will be demonstrated.
-
At the end of the course, the osteopath will acquire a methodology to develop a sensory experience of the spontaneous therapeutic process of Automatic Shifting, occurring after the neutral.
Phase III will cover:
-
The embryological dural development up to a full adult including the anterior dural girdle and its clinical significance.
-
Diagnosis and treatment of intra-membranous shearing will be appreciated with the Long Tide.
-
This course will also enhance perceptual skills to distinguish between periosteal dura, meningeal dura and CNS, by finding the presence of the Therapeutic Forces of the Long Tide in the lesion.
-
The principles of treatment and clinical significance of the peritoneal sac are discussed.
-
The clinical significance and principles of treatment of the neuro-immune-endocrine connection and CV3 - the Bird- will be explored.
-
Throughout the course, the skill of tempo, humility and synchronizing with the Health will be developed.
